第一题
import java.util.Scanner;
public class Keda1 {
public static void main(String[] args) {
Scanner input = new Scanner(System.in);
String line = input.nextLine();
String[] nums = line.split(",");
int n = Integer.valueOf(nums[0]);
int m = Integer.valueOf(nums[1]);
int[][] pan = new int[n][m];
for (int i = 0; i < n; i++) {
String[] stmp = input.nextLine().split(" ");
for (int j = 0; j < m; j++) {
pan[i][j] = Integer.valueOf(stmp[j]);
}
}
int[][] ans = pan;
for (int i = 1; i < m; i++) {
ans[0][i] = ans[0][i] + ans[0][i - 1];
}
for (int i = 1; i < n; i++) {
ans[i][0] = ans[i][0] + ans[i - 1][0];
}
for (int i = 1; i < n; i++) {
for (int j = 1; j < m; j++) {
ans[i][j] = Math.max(ans[i - 1][j], ans[i][j - 1]) + ans[i][j];
}
}
System.out.println(ans[n - 1][m - 1]);
}
}
